Under the Plastic Waste Management (Amendment) Rules, 2026, companies that fail to meet their Extended Producer Responsibility (EPR) recycling targets for FY 2025–26 are no longer immediately penalized. Instead, the unfulfilled targets can be carried forward for up to three subsequent years (starting from FY 2026–27), provided that at least one-third of the deficit is cleared every year. This amendment represents a compliance relaxation intended to give producers, importers, and brand owners (PIBOs) additional time to scale up recycling infrastructure. However, critics argue this flexibility could delay accountability and undermine the overall EPR framework, especially since the Central Pollution Control Board (CPCB) had already found over 6 lakh fake recycling certificates in 2023, raising concerns about system integrity.
Key Features of the 2026 Plastic Waste Amendment
- Carry-forward provision: Up to 3 years (FY 2026–27 onwards), clearing 1/3rd annually
- No immediate penalty: For FY 2025–26 target shortfall
- Tradable certificate system: Companies can buy credits from over-performers
- Fake certificate issue: CPCB found 6 lakh+ fake certificates in 2023
- 100% collection mandate: Due by FY 2024–25 under original EPR framework
